Are Neoprene Ankle Sleeves Bad for Your Ankles?

Are Neoprene Ankle Sleeves Bad for Your Ankles?

Neoprene compression sleeves are widely used by runners, lifters, and everyday athletes. Many people use these wraps to soothe minor aches or add stability during exercise. However, a debate exists around whether reliance on neoprene can cause long-term joint weakness. Evaluating neoprene sleeves requires looking at how synthetic materials interact with joint mechanics and neuromuscular feedback. Understanding these dynamics helps clarify whether compression wraps promote recovery or hinder long-term stability.

 

Mechanics of Neoprene Compression and Joint Stability

Neoprene provides elasticity, thermal insulation, and uniform pressure. When wrapped around a joint, the material exerts mild pressure, aiding local blood flow and increasing tissue temperature. Higher temperatures improve tissue flexibility, helping reduce stiffness during dynamic movements.

Neoprene also enhances proprioception—the neurological process through which the brain senses body position. Continuous tactile pressure stimulates skin sensory receptors, signaling the central nervous system to maintain alignment. This mechanical feedback makes movement feel more controlled, which is why a general ankle support is widely used during exercise routines.

However, neoprene sleeves do not provide rigid structural immobilization. Unlike a heavy-duty leg and ankle brace designed to restrict movement after severe injury, a flexible neoprene sleeve compresses soft tissue without stopping rollover movements.

 

Common Misconceptions About Muscle Dependency and Weakness

The primary concern regarding neoprene sleeves is the potential for muscle atrophy. A common worry is that wearing compression gear causes surrounding muscles and ligaments to lose their natural stabilizing ability.

Passive Support versus Structural Dependency

Structural dependency typically occurs with rigid orthotics that completely restrict joint articulation. When a rigid ankle brace prevents natural joint movement over extended periods, surrounding muscles experience reduced load, leading to disuse weakness. Flexible neoprene sleeves operate on a different principle. Because neoprene stretches, the muscles and tendons surrounding the joint must still contract to control movement. The sleeve offers external sensory feedback rather than taking over the physical workload.

Proprioceptive Loss from Overuse

While true muscle atrophy is unlikely from soft sleeves, continuous reliance on compression during non-strenuous tasks can dull tactile sensitivity. If sensory receptors are constantly exposed to external pressure, the brain may adapt, slightly lowering natural awareness when the sleeve is removed. Wearing support only during demanding activities helps preserve natural reflexes.

 

Overview of Ankle Support Options

Selecting the right level of support depends on the severity of joint instability and physical body structure.

Support Type Stabilization Primary Use
Neoprene Sleeve Mild General soreness, warm-up
Rigid Brace High Acute sprains, post-injury
Lace-up Brace Moderate to High Chronic instability, court sports
Bariatric Support Moderate Heavy structural loads, wider fit

Sleeve Options

Soft sleeves deliver mild compression and thermal retention. They improve local blood circulation and provide light sensory awareness without restricting dynamic range of motion.

Rigid Options

Hard outer shells lined with foam or gel pods provide maximum mechanical control. These units physically block side-to-side translation, making them essential for severe injuries or heavy contact activities.

Lace-Up Options

Constructed from dense canvas or heavy nylon, lace-up units mimic non-elastic athletic taping. They restrict lateral rollover while fitting snugly inside standard athletic shoes.

Fitting and Material Considerations Across Different Body Types

An ill-fitting compression sleeve can cause physical problems. Excessively tight sleeves restrict blood flow and venous return. Signs of improper fit include numbness, tingling, skin discoloration, or deep indentations in soft tissue.

Body proportions play a significant role in fit accuracy. Standard compression garments are graded on average limb proportions, which often fail individuals with larger calves or fluid retention. For broader limb structures, a specialized plus size ankle brace offers an anatomical cut that distributes pressure evenly across the lower leg without cutting off circulation.

Proper sizing requires measuring the circumference of the heel and ankle. Potential Risks of Prolonged Neoprene Wear

While neoprene sleeves offer comfort, improper usage habits can lead to complications related to skin health and circulation.

Moisture Accumulation and Dermatological Issues

Neoprene traps heat and sweat against the skin. Prolonged exposure to trapped moisture can cause skin maceration, contact dermatitis, or fungal growth. Washing the garment regularly with mild soap and allowing the skin to breathe prevents sweat-related irritation.

Circulatory Restriction During Rest

Compression garments are designed for active use when muscle contractions assist in pumping blood. During rest, baseline blood pressure drops, making tight garments more likely to impede circulation. For this reason, sleeping with ankle brace sleeves made of non-breathable neoprene is generally discouraged unless directed for specific medical management. Resting in tight, heat-retaining wraps can lead to localized swelling, tissue throbbing, and skin irritation overnight.

Neglecting Active Rehabilitation

Relying entirely on passive supports like a plus size ankle brace or standard neoprene sleeve without performing strengthening exercises creates a false sense of security. Compression garments cushion movement, but they do not rebuild torn ligaments. Combining supportive gear with targeted balance and resistance exercises ensures long-term joint health.

 

Best Practices for Safe Use

Using neoprene compression sleeves safely requires incorporating them into a comprehensive approach to joint care.

  • Wear compression gear during high-impact training, prolonged standing, or active sport participation, then remove it afterward.

  • Keep the joint active through strength, flexibility, and balance exercises to build natural stability.

  • Ensure the sleeve fits comfortably without causing numbness, pain, or deep skin marks.

  • Remove synthetic sleeves before bed to allow skin aeration and uninterrupted circulation.

  • Clean the sleeve regularly to prevent bacteria and sweat buildup.

When chosen in the correct size and used during active movement, neoprene sleeves provide thermal insulation, proprioceptive feedback, and mild swelling control without causing joint weakness. Combining supportive gear with proactive strength training provides the most effective approach to long-term joint durability.
